About the Author

  I started writing poetry when I was about 13 years old.  I was one of those people that loved English and Reading, and hated Math and Government.

  I started writing my feelings down and it just so happened they rhymed.  (That was a joke) Sometimes, I get so involved with my poems; I start to sound like Dr. Suess, even in a normal conversation. Once I started working, after my daughter was of school age, it just started to be a ritual over and over of people asking me to do simple poems for them.

  Sometimes it was for a birth, sometimes for a funeral. Reunions, promotions…etc. I enjoyed doing it so much; I kind of became “the poet” for my company. I always wrote my inner feelings for each and every one. But a lot of times I wrote things with an inspiration of what I overheard people say, their open feelings.

  I can never write fast enough. Sometimes when I am writing I can’t write it fast enough for the fear that I will lose that exact thought that I have in that moment. Well, go figure; I am not an expert as far as I know. I just write what I feel, and feel what I write.

  I grew up in Mississippi and still reside here. I went through all the problems and pains that everyone else in this world has. My family growing up was not perfect, and my life isn’t perfect now.

  I just want you to realize, that as you are reading my collection, that I am just like you. I have pains. I have conflicts, and I have moments that I think the world will end soon.
